Redefining the Purpose of Saving



For years, typical financial advice has leaned greatly on the concepts of thriftiness, delayed satisfaction, and aggressive conserving. From eliminating early morning coffee to discarding holidays, the message has actually been loud and clear: save now, appreciate later. But as social worths change and people reassess what financial health truly indicates, a softer, a lot more conscious strategy to money is gaining grip. This is the significance of soft conserving-- an arising way of thinking that focuses much less on stockpiling cash and even more on lining up monetary decisions with a significant, cheerful life.



Soft conserving doesn't mean deserting obligation. It's not about overlooking your future or investing recklessly. Rather, it's about equilibrium. It's concerning identifying that life is taking place currently, and your money ought to support your happiness, not simply your pension.



The Emotional Side of Money



Money is often deemed a numbers video game, yet the means we gain, invest, and conserve is deeply psychological. From childhood experiences to social stress, our monetary practices are shaped by more than reasoning. Aggressive conserving strategies, while effective theoretically, can often fuel stress and anxiety, shame, and a persistent anxiety of "not having enough."



Soft conserving welcomes us to take into consideration how we feel concerning our economic choices. Are you avoiding dinner with pals since you're attempting to stay with an inflexible financial savings plan? Are you postponing that road trip you've dreamed concerning for years due to the fact that it does not appear "accountable?" Soft conserving challenges these narratives by asking: what's the emotional price of severe conserving?



Why Millennials and Gen Z Are Shifting Gears



The more recent generations aren't necessarily gaining much more, but they are reimagining what riches resembles. After experiencing economic economic downturns, real estate crises, and currently browsing post-pandemic realities, younger individuals are examining the wisdom of postponing delight for a later date that isn't guaranteed.



They're selecting experiences over belongings. They're focusing on psychological health, versatile work, and day-to-day satisfaction. And they're doing it while still maintaining a sense of monetary duty-- simply by themselves terms. This shift has actually motivated even more people to reassess what they actually desire from their financial journey: peace of mind, not perfection.

Releasing the "All or Nothing" Mindset



One of the biggest challenges in personal finance is the tendency to think in extremes. You're either saving every penny or you're failing. You're either settling all financial obligation or you're behind. Soft saving introduces nuance. It claims you can conserve and invest. You can plan for the future and reside in today.



For example, many people feel bewildered when picking between travel and paying for a lending. But what if you allocated modestly for both? By making room for joy, you could really feel even more inspired and equipped to stay on track with your economic goals.
